Hello {NAME} I grew up in the age of dial-up internet, living more than 30 kilometers away from the Philippine capital. To that kid, having an encyclopedia set felt like a big deal. The set we had consisted of more than 10 books: Each volume was thicker than the Bible and looked like it came from a century-old library. My mom wanted her daughters to have good grades in school, so she thought an encyclopedia was a good purchase. But the question of whether it was indeed helpful for our studies is another story. My motherâs decision to buy the set was also influenced by a neighbor who worked as a sales agent for an encyclopedia publishing company. Looking back to it now, I can say that such agents were - and still are - effective marketers even in the age of social commerce. Vietnam's MFast, a financial marketplace that relies on agents to sell its products, is proof of that. The company says it is ending the year with at least US$11 million in revenue and hopes to turn profitable by 2025.
